So I decided to figure it out to install it on my system, and it’s quite easy.

You might follow these simple steps to get it working. I’m using Dell Vostro 3560, so there’s probability that it may be different comparing to your case.

Check if Fingerprint Reader is recognized on your system

lsusb

My output is as follow, notice the 6th line, my hardware is Validity Sensors, Inc. VFS5011 Fingerprint Reader

Bus 003 Device 003: ID 138a:0011 Validity Sensors, Inc. VFS5011 Fingerprint Reader

Install fPrint

$ sudo add-apt-repository ppa:fingerprint/fprint
$ sudo apt-get update
$ sudo apt-get install libpam-fprintd

You might be required to type in your account password before the installation begins.

To check whether the installation succeed, a file name common-auth should be created already in your system. Check the content of this file, you should see the following line:

$ grep fprint /etc/pam.d/common-auth
auth	[success=2 default=ignore]	pam_fprintd.so max_tries=1 timeout=10 # debug


Register your fingerprint

Use the following command to register your fingerprint, it will ask you to swipe your finger several times:

$ fprint-enroll

Keep swiping your finger until finish:

Using device /net/reactivated/Fprint/Device/0
Enrolling right-index-finger finger.
Enroll result: enroll-stage-passed
Enroll result: enroll-stage-passed
Enroll result: enroll-stage-passed
Enroll result: enroll-stage-passed
Enroll result: enroll-completed

And you are done. Now everytime you do something that require entering password like login, package installation, you will be prompted to swipe your finger to continue, like following:

$ sudo apt-get install ruby ruby-dev make gcc nodejs
Swipe your finger across the fingerprint reader
